Business Idea:
A platform that helps founders build and validate startup ideas by engaging with a community, sharing progress, and gathering feedback early on to attract interest before launch.
Problem:
Founders struggle to validate ideas, build an early community, and generate initial enthusiasm without spending too much time or resources.
Solution:
An online community and dashboard where founders share their startup journey publicly, gather feedback from followers, and iterate based on real-time input to refine their ideas before launching.
Target Audience:
Early-stage founders, entrepreneurs, and startup teams looking to validate ideas, build a following, and reduce launch risk.
Monetization:
Subscription plans for premium features, early-access tools, and mentorship opportunities; potential partnership with accelerators or investors.
Unique Selling Proposition (USP):
Combines public build-in-public strategies with community engagement, allowing founders to validate ideas, build a loyal following, and iterate transparently—differentiating it from traditional MVP or incubator models.
Launch Strategy:
Start by creating a simple website and social channels, invite early founders to share their “origin stories,” and offer a basic feedback system to gauge interest. Use initial engagement to refine features and build momentum.
